GatewayRouteConfigProperties interface
Konfigurace tras rozhraní API brány Spring Cloud
Vlastnosti
app |
ID prostředku aplikace Azure Spring Apps, které se vyžaduje, pokud trasa nedefinuje |
filters | Úprava požadavku před jeho odesláním do cílového koncového bodu nebo přijaté odpovědi na úrovni aplikace |
open |
Vlastnosti OpenAPI konfigurace směrování brány Spring Cloud |
predicates | Několik podmínek pro vyhodnocení trasy pro jednotlivé požadavky na úrovni aplikace. Každý predikát může být vyhodnocen oproti hlavičkám požadavku a hodnotám parametrů. Všechny predikáty přidružené k trase se musí vyhodnotit jako true, aby se trasa shodovala s požadavkem. |
protocol | Protokol směrovaných aplikací Azure Spring Apps |
provisioning |
Stav konfigurace trasy brány Spring Cloud POZNÁMKA: Tato vlastnost nebude serializována. Naplnit ho může jenom server. |
routes | Pole tras rozhraní API, každá trasa obsahuje vlastnosti jako |
sso |
Povolte jeden Sign-On na úrovni aplikace. |
Podrobnosti vlastnosti
appResourceId
ID prostředku aplikace Azure Spring Apps, které se vyžaduje, pokud trasa nedefinuje uri
.
appResourceId?: string
Hodnota vlastnosti
string
filters
Úprava požadavku před jeho odesláním do cílového koncového bodu nebo přijaté odpovědi na úrovni aplikace
filters?: string[]
Hodnota vlastnosti
string[]
openApi
Vlastnosti OpenAPI konfigurace směrování brány Spring Cloud
openApi?: GatewayRouteConfigOpenApiProperties
Hodnota vlastnosti
predicates
Několik podmínek pro vyhodnocení trasy pro jednotlivé požadavky na úrovni aplikace. Každý predikát může být vyhodnocen oproti hlavičkám požadavku a hodnotám parametrů. Všechny predikáty přidružené k trase se musí vyhodnotit jako true, aby se trasa shodovala s požadavkem.
predicates?: string[]
Hodnota vlastnosti
string[]
protocol
Protokol směrovaných aplikací Azure Spring Apps
protocol?: string
Hodnota vlastnosti
string
provisioningState
Stav konfigurace trasy brány Spring Cloud POZNÁMKA: Tato vlastnost nebude serializována. Naplnit ho může jenom server.
provisioningState?: string
Hodnota vlastnosti
string
routes
Pole tras rozhraní API, každá trasa obsahuje vlastnosti jako title
, uri
, ssoEnabled
, , predicates
. filters
routes?: GatewayApiRoute[]
Hodnota vlastnosti
ssoEnabled
Povolte jeden Sign-On na úrovni aplikace.
ssoEnabled?: boolean
Hodnota vlastnosti
boolean